An essential aspect of their work involves upgrading power products, which has ended up being here significantly essential as homes on the North Shore embrace advanced technologies such as photovoltaic panels, high-energy appliances, and electrical automobile battery chargers. These contemporary facilities typically exceed the capacity of outdated single-phase power connections and undersized consumer mains, requiring an upgrade to prevent overloading and non-compliance. With the requisite know-how and permission, a Level 2 Electrician on the North Shore can securely disconnect the existing power supply, update the consumer mains to heavier-duty cables, and if needed, shift the connection to a more robust three-phase system, thereby supporting the increased power needs of contemporary households while keeping safety and compliance requirements.
Additionally, a Level 2 Electrician in the North Shore location plays an essential role in handling electrical issues. Homeowners in the vicinity may get a notice about electrical flaws from the network operator, like Ausgrid, which requires the prompt correction of faults on the service-side devices. These problems often include matters beyond the knowledge of a regular electrician, such as a damaged personal power pole, a malfunctioning service fuse, or an inadequate earthing system. The Level 2 Electrician in the North Shore area holds the necessary accreditation to attend to these concerns, carry out the needed repair work or replacements, and finish the essential documentation to deal with the problem notice, thus averting disconnection from the power grid. The installation and upkeep of private power poles is another signature service of the Level 2 Electrician North Shore. In numerous bigger or set-back North Shore homes, a personal power pole is utilized to bring the overhead service line from the street to the structure. The upkeep of this pole and the conductors attached to it falls squarely on the homeowner. Whether the pole is timber needing replacement due to rot, or steel harmed by corrosion or effect, a Level 2 Electrician North Shore is the only professional authorised to perform the setup, repair, or complete replacement, constantly making sure the new infrastructure meets the extensive structural and electrical requirements set out in New South Wales. Their expertise likewise covers the installation and upkeep of both overhead and underground service lines, including the safe use of specialised equipment like cherry pickers and excavators for intricate gain access to or trenching.
In the field of electrical metering, a Level 2 Electrician North Shore manages the setup and adjustment of meters, incorporating new setups for residential and business properties, meter relocations throughout structure repairs, and the setup of advanced smart meters that deal with variable tariffs and photovoltaic panel systems. They manage the administrative tasks and collaborate with the energy provider to ensure exact measurement and reporting of energy intake from the preliminary power activation.
